Pallets/bulk/IBC

This category includes stories on reusable packaging used in the transport and distribution of products. These include wooden or plastic pallets, bulk shipping containers, and intermediate bulk containers.

  • Factors impacting the environmental sustainability of pallet programs*

    As this white paper from IFCO Systems explains, when the sustainable packaging movement first began, attention was initially focused on primary or “consumer” packaging. As the movement evolved, it became clear that secondary or “transport” packaging, such as bulk containers and pallets, also had significant impact on the environment.
